3 types derived from SdkResolverLoader
Microsoft.Build (1)
BackEnd\Components\SdkResolution\CachingSdkResolverLoader.cs (1)
15
internal sealed class CachingSdkResolverLoader :
SdkResolverLoader
Microsoft.Build.Engine.UnitTests (2)
BackEnd\SdkResolverLoader_Tests.cs (1)
453
private sealed class MockSdkResolverLoader :
SdkResolverLoader
BackEnd\SdkResolverService_Tests.cs (1)
739
private sealed class MockLoaderStrategy :
SdkResolverLoader
10 instantiations of SdkResolverLoader
Microsoft.Build (1)
BackEnd\Components\SdkResolution\SdkResolverService.cs (1)
67
: new
SdkResolverLoader
();
Microsoft.Build.Engine.UnitTests (9)
BackEnd\SdkResolverLoader_Tests.cs (9)
45
var loader = new
SdkResolverLoader
();
77
var strategy = new
SdkResolverLoader
();
109
SdkResolverLoader loader = new
SdkResolverLoader
();
232
SdkResolverLoader loader = new
SdkResolverLoader
();
258
SdkResolverLoader loader = new
SdkResolverLoader
();
284
SdkResolverLoader loader = new
SdkResolverLoader
();
300
SdkResolverLoader loader = new
SdkResolverLoader
();
325
SdkResolverLoader loader = new
SdkResolverLoader
();
387
SdkResolverLoader loader = new
SdkResolverLoader
();
21 references to SdkResolverLoader
Microsoft.Build (7)
BackEnd\Components\SdkResolution\CachingSdkResolverLoader.cs (2)
12
/// A subclass of <see cref="
SdkResolverLoader
"/> which creates resolver manifests and SDK resolvers only once and
47
/// a static instance as opposed to creating <see cref="CachingSdkResolverLoader"/> or <see cref="
SdkResolverLoader
"/> for each
BackEnd\Components\SdkResolution\MainNodeSdkResolverService.cs (1)
42
internal void InitializeForTests(
SdkResolverLoader
resolverLoader = null, IReadOnlyList<SdkResolver> resolvers = null)
BackEnd\Components\SdkResolution\SdkResolverService.cs (4)
59
/// Stores an <see cref="
SdkResolverLoader
"/> which can load registered SDK resolvers.
65
protected
SdkResolverLoader
_sdkResolverLoader = ChangeWaves.AreFeaturesEnabled(ChangeWaves.Wave17_10)
400
/// <param name="resolverLoader">An <see cref="
SdkResolverLoader
"/> to use for loading SDK resolvers.</param>
402
internal virtual void InitializeForTests(
SdkResolverLoader
resolverLoader = null, IReadOnlyList<SdkResolver> resolvers = null)
Microsoft.Build.Engine.UnitTests (14)
BackEnd\SdkResolverLoader_Tests.cs (13)
45
var
loader = new SdkResolverLoader();
77
var
strategy = new SdkResolverLoader();
109
SdkResolverLoader
loader = new SdkResolverLoader();
127
SdkResolverLoader
sdkResolverLoader = new MockSdkResolverLoader
159
SdkResolverLoader
sdkResolverLoader = new MockSdkResolverLoader
191
SdkResolverLoader
sdkResolverLoader = new MockSdkResolverLoader
232
SdkResolverLoader
loader = new SdkResolverLoader();
258
SdkResolverLoader
loader = new SdkResolverLoader();
284
SdkResolverLoader
loader = new SdkResolverLoader();
300
SdkResolverLoader
loader = new SdkResolverLoader();
325
SdkResolverLoader
loader = new SdkResolverLoader();
341
SdkResolverLoader
loader = new MockSdkResolverLoader()
387
SdkResolverLoader
loader = new SdkResolverLoader();
BackEnd\SdkResolverService_Tests.cs (1)
719
internal override void InitializeForTests(
SdkResolverLoader
resolverLoader = null, IReadOnlyList<SdkResolver> resolvers = null)